回答:
DoubleCommandを使用して、MacBook Pro上のMac OS X 10.6 Snow Leopardでキーを正常に再マッピングしました。
右下のOptionキーをリマップしてCtrlキーに変更しました(私はemacsユーザーです。両側にCtrlキーを持たないのは大変な痛みです)。
~/Library/KeyBindings/これを作成して保存すると、ホームを変更して終了できますDefaultKeyBinding.dict。
{
"\UF729" = moveToBeginningOfLine:;
"\UF72B" = moveToEndOfLine:;
"$\UF729" = moveToBeginningOfLineAndModifySelection:;
"$\UF72B" = moveToEndOfLineAndModifySelection:;
"@\UF729" = moveToBeginningOfDocument:;
"@\UF72B" = moveToEndOfDocument:;
}
@=⌘、$=⇧、\UF729=↖、\UF72B=↘、\UF72C=⇞、\UF72D=⇟
"\UF72D" = pageDown:;また、ページを下に移動してキャレットを移動しますがpageDown:、WebビューまたはiWorkアプリケーションでは機能しません。
詳細については、Cocoa Text Systemの記事、私のWebサイト、またはTextMateブログのこの投稿を参照してください。
他にもいくつかのオプションがあります。
http://pqrs.org/macosx/keyremap4macbook/(名前にもかかわらず、すべてのMacキーボードで動作します)
http://scripts.sil.org/cms/scripts/page.php?site_id=nrsi&id=ukelele(これは、多言語の目的のためにキーボードを再マッピングのためのより多くのですが、それはまだあなたに合うかもしれません)